  • Unable to load itunes store in windows 7 64bit

    Hi, installed 10.5... on Windows 7, 64bit machine and now cannot access Itunes Store.  Appears to begin loading then stalls out.  Have tried uninstalling and reinstalling.  Tried running in compatibility mode.  Daughters laptop (same operating system, different manufacturer) is having the same problem.

    Close your iTunes,
    Go to command Prompt -
    (Win 7/Vista) - START/ALL PROGRAMS/ACCESSORIES, right mouse click "Command Prompt", choose "Run as Administrator".
    (Win XP SP2 & above) - START/ALL PROGRAMS/ACCESSORIES/Command Prompt
    In the "Command Prompt" screen, type in
    netsh winsock reset
    Hit "ENTER" key
    Restart your computer.
    If you do get a prompt after restart windows to remap LSP, just click NO.
    Now launch your iTunes and see if it is working now.
    If you are still having these type of problems after trying the winsock reset, refer to this article to identify which software in your system is inserting LSP:
    iTunes 10.5 for Windows: May see performance issues and blank iTunes Store

  • I can't load itunes to my windows 7, i get an error 7 (windows error 127) everytime i download an itunes and try to open it.

    i have a windows 7 and was trying to upload iTunes, i get the error 7 (windows error 127).  I had itunes before but i tried to upgrade it, not i can't even load back an itunes, can anyone help?

    Uninstall your existing copy of iTunes. Delete any copies of the iTunesSetup.exe (or iTunes64Setup.exe) installer file from your downloads areas for your web browsers and download a fresh copy of the iTunes installer file from the Apple website:
    http://www.apple.com/itunes/download/
    (The current build of the 11.1.4.62 installer was changed a few days ago, which fixed the bulk of the reports of MSVCR80.dll/R6034/APSDaemon.exe/Error-7/AMDS-could-not-start trouble ... but the build number on the installer was not changed. So we're trying to make sure you do the reinstall using a "new good" 11.1.4.62 installer instead of an "old bad".)
    Does the install with the new copy of the installer go through properly? If so, does that clear up the error message?
    If you still have the same error messages cropping up, then try the procedures from the following user tip:
